In 1819, during a period when the Romantic movement was redefining artistic expression, John Buckler was immersed in documenting the beauty of English architecture. Working primarily in Yorkshire, he aimed to capture the essence of his surroundings, blending personal emotion with an architectural focus.
This particular work reflects both his dedication to detailed representation and an appreciation for the joy that spaces like this can evoke in their memories.
